Pain is in your head. Pain is not out there in theea, real world. We know that if people have pain at different times through the day, they'll perceive it less than other times. If you're anticipating pain, then it's perceived as more. I've also heard reports that patients on morphine will sometimes say they still feel the pain, but it doesn't matter any more. There's a very subjective element to pain. And i think this is a very interesting way in to understanding consciousness.
